Overview

Postcode HA3 6BU is located in a major urban area, within the Harrow Weald ward of Harrow in the London region, and forms part of the Harrow Weald area. It has average deprivation and low crime levels, with around 42.1 crimes per 1,000 residents per year, about 67% below the London average of 130 per 1,000. The average income per household in Harrow Weald is £72,516 per year. The nearest station is Headstone Lane, about 1.2 miles away. There are 7 primary and 4 secondary schools in the area. There is 1 park nearby, the closest medium park is Harrow Weald Recreation Ground.

Deprivation level

6/10

Harrow Weald has an average level of deprivation, ranked at position 13,850 out of 32,844 areas in the United Kingdom, placing it within the top 42% most deprived areas in England.

Crime level

3/10

Harrow Weald has a low crime rate, with approximately 42.1 reported incidents per 1,000 population each year.

Social housing

22.8%

Approximately 22.8% of homes on this street are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. Across the surrounding area, around 10.9% of dwellings are socially rented.
